Accidents, Injuries or Near Misses
If an accident occurs firstly make sure that the involved people are assisted in the most appropriate manner. All accidents, incidents and near misses that occur in the University must be reported
- the report form is available as an online form - you will need to be signed in to use this form.
Please ensure that the management of the area are made aware of the incident as soon as possible, either verbally or by copy of the report form.
First Aid
Any person on the University site may suffer injuries or fall ill. The arrangements in place for First Aid mean that someone can provide them with immediate attention or call an ambulance if needed. This can save lives and prevent minor injuries becoming major ones.
If you need a first aider you can contact one close to you, either in the same building or one close by. Please see this list to find your nearest first aider. In addition all Security staff are trained First Aiders.
Fire
Fire is potentially the greatest of all risks to personnel, business continuity and property. It can spread extremely quickly producing toxic, asphyxiating smoke. Fire hazards arise from structural features, the use to which the building is put, and the behaviour of people occupying and using the building.
